What Portion of the RV Does the Stromberg Ladder LA-401BA Attach To
Question:
I owned a 2015 Forest River Sunseekers model 2250LE, I am looking for a ladder that will fit this model. Do I need a blueprint to tell me where to mount this. Thank you and looking forward to hear from anyone of you.
asked by: Tony Y
0
Expert Reply:
To install a RV ladder like the part # LA-401BA you need to make sure it's attaching to the subframe or support pegs of the RV's structure so that the ladder is properly braced.
If you are uncertain if your RV has backing installed, you should contact your RV manufacture to confirm. It is unsafe to use a ladder that is not connected to the RVs backing or sub frame.
